The learning objective for the first term was for the students to build upon their confidence to introduce themselves through speech in Mandarin. Our teachers tailored the Show and Tell activity so that the students were provided with an opportunity to share their work with their peers, while developing their proficiency in Mandarin. More importantly, the social interaction under the close guidance of the teachers enabled the students to be more confident in Mandarin speaking at a pace most comfortable to them.
Initially, we observed that the majority of the students were quiet and shy during the Show and Tell activity. However, after a few of the students started volunteering to go first and walked around to share the project work on their hand, the rest were able to catch on quickly. It brought the teaching team great pride to see the students interacting with each other in Mandarin. We could see that the students were laughing and enjoying the session after overcoming the initial apprehension of introducing themselves in another language.
Overall our Year 3 students have done very well. They deserve a pat on the back for the progress they have made this term. Our teaching team are confident they are ready for further challenges in the term to come!
